Sudan crisis, NRC Regional Response Plan 2024 – 2025 (Sudan, South Sudan, Chad, Egypt, Libya)
01.01.2024
- 28.02.2026
Sudan has become one the world worst humanitarian crisis. Nearly 18 months of war have turned it into the fastest growing displacement crisis. By the end of November 2024, an estimated 11.36 million people were internally displaced. In addition, more than 3.2 million people have fled across borders. Major bureaucratic and administrative impediments, financial collapse, market disruptions, and insecurity are hampering aid efforts. NRC plans to assist over 3.1 m conflict-affected people, focusing on those with severe needs and in hard-to-reach areas.

OCHA Humanitarian Forum Sudan Crisis
01.12.2023
- 31.12.2024
Following the outbreak of violence between the Sudanese Armed Forces (SAF) and the Rapid Support Forces (RSF) millions of Sudanese face dire humanitarian needs. The warring parties committed in Jeddah on 7th November to improve the safe and unhindered humanitarian access to persons in need. As part of this commitment, the RSF and the SAF agreed to participate in an OCHA led Humanitarian Forum to work out the operational details.

SUD, OCHA: Sudan Humanitarian Fund 2023
01.01.2023
- 31.12.2023
The SHF is a country-based pooled fund that contributes to saving lives and protecting people in need by strengthening a coordinated and principled humanitarian response. Since 2006, the SHF has received over USD 1.4 bn from 15 countries and private donors. It enables humanitarian actors to respond early and fast to humanitarian needs set out in the Humanitarian Response Plan (HRP) and to critical emergency incidences. All interventions are in line with the Minimum Operating Standards approved by the Humanitarian Country Team.
